The photograph shows the Dayton-Wright "The Messenger" at the Dayton-Wright Airplane Company. "The Messenger" was a small airplane that was powered by a two-cycle four cylinder engine. The aircraft was a single seat model and resembled the De Havilland DH-4 in design. The view of the aircraft is from the tail section looking forward to the front while the aircraft is parked in the middle of an open field. The negative is numbered 65.
